How Expert Advisors Work in Forex Trading
Expert Advisors (EAs) function within trading platforms like MetaTrader 4 (MT4) and MetaTrader 5 (MT5). These platforms allow traders to install automated scripts that:
- Monitor price movements
- Identify trade signals
- Execute buy/sell orders
- Manage stop loss and take profit levels

Comparison With Other Forex EAs
Compared to grid or martingale systems, wave-based EAs often focus more on trend precision rather than aggressive recovery strategies.
Martingale systems increase lot sizes after losses, which can lead to catastrophic drawdowns. Wave-based strategies generally aim for controlled entries.
Each approach carries unique risks.

Risk Management Tips for Automated Trading
Even with automation, smart risk management is non-negotiable.
Here’s what experienced traders recommend:
- Risk no more than 1–2% per trade
- Avoid trading during major economic news
- Use a VPS for stable connectivity
- Withdraw partial profits regularly
- Monitor performance weekly
Automation doesn’t mean “set and forget.” It means “monitor and manage.”
